The LA Clippers will host the Detroit Pistons at the Crypto.com Arena on 17th November.
While the two teams share a long history, since 2000, the Clippers and Pistons have played 31 matches against each other. Out of these 31 games, the LA Clippers have won 20 times, while the Detroit Pistons won 11 times. The two teams played their last game on 14th November, where the Clippers won by a score of 106:102. The last six matches played between the two teams have ended in a win for the Clippers, while the Pistons won their last game against LA Clippers in 2019.

LA Clippers Statistics
The Clippers are placed in the third position in the Pacific Division, having won 8 out of 15 games played in the season so far. The team played its last game as underdogs against Dallas Mavericks on Tuesday and lost by 103:101.
The team was on the road for its previous two matches and had won against the Houston Rockets on Monday night by 122: 106. After its loss to the Mavericks, it now sits behind the Sacramento Kings and Phoenix Suns in NBA’s pacific division.
This year, the LA Clippers are ranked 30th in the league, with their offence scoring an average of 105.21 points per game. The team is 21st in rebounding, with 42.71 boards in a night. Their field goal percentage is 47.36, putting them at 9th in the league. Paul George leads the team with 24.4 points, 4.6 assists, and 6.1 rebounds a night.
On the defence side, the Clippers have conceded an average of 107.14 points, putting them in 4th place in the league.
Detroit Pistons Statistics
The Detroit Pistons are ranked 5th in the Eastern Conference and 15th in the Eastern Conference, having won only three games and losing 11 games so far in the season. On Monday, the Pistons lost their match against the Toronto Raptors by a score of 111:115.
The team had struggled over the previous game and came into Monday’s game with a three-game losing streak, only to turn the count to four. The team has scored an average of 108.53 points per game and is ranked 27th in the league. The Pistons’ rebound score stands at 44.20, ranking them at 16 in the league, while their field score percentage is 42.86%. Bojan Bogdanovic is the team’s lead scorer, averaging 20.1 points, 2.1 assists, and 3.5 points per game.
The defence side of the Detroit Pistons has been a major factor behind the team’s below-par performance. The team has conceded an average of 118.20 points per game, placing them at 29th in the league. Their rebound percentage has been 47.07, placing them at 28th in the league. If they want to break their losing streak, they will have to do a better job at defence.
